I'm putting all new lines and compressor on my IH 886. I'm going to put it all on and my mechanic is going to draw it down and charge it back up when I am done (it's a favor - he usually only works on cars/pickups). He asked me how much refrigerant the tractor holds. Anyone have any idea?
 
I'm gonna GUESS original R-12 charge was in the 3 to 4 lb. range.

ASSUMING you are going with R134A, typically (by weight) it will take 80% of that.

It has a sight glass which will NOT completely clear of bubbles like it did with R12, and watching that begin to clear, and monitoring the low-side pressure vs. ambient temp will help him decide when to quit adding refrigerant.
